The way people discover information online is changing rapidly. Traditional search engines are no longer the only gateway to content. Today, users increasingly rely on AI-powered platforms such as ChatGPT, Gemini, Perplexity, and Google AI Overviews to receive direct answers instead of browsing multiple search results.
This shift has created a new challenge for content marketers, publishers, and businesses: how can your content appear inside AI-generated answers?
The answer lies in implementing a strong GEO strategy for visibility in generative search.
Generative Engine Optimization (GEO) is emerging as the next evolution of digital visibility. While SEO remains important, GEO focuses on helping AI systems discover, understand, trust, and cite your content when generating responses. As AI-driven search becomes a primary source of information discovery, content teams must adapt their strategies accordingly.
Understanding GEO in 2026
GEO, or Generative Engine Optimization, is the practice of optimizing content so that AI-powered search engines and answer engines can retrieve and reference it within generated responses. Unlike traditional SEO, which focuses on ranking web pages, GEO focuses on becoming a trusted source that AI systems choose to cite.
When a user asks an AI assistant a question, the system often gathers information from multiple sources, synthesizes it, and presents a summarized answer. If your content is structured correctly and demonstrates authority, it has a better chance of being included in that response. Research has shown that GEO-focused optimization can significantly improve content visibility within generative search environments.
Why Traditional SEO Is No Longer Enough
For years, content teams followed a familiar process:
Research keywords
Analyze competitors
Create optimized content
Build backlinks
Improve rankings
While these fundamentals still matter, AI search introduces new requirements. Content must now be designed not only for human readers and search engine crawlers but also for AI systems that extract specific passages and synthesize information.
A page ranking well on Google does not automatically guarantee visibility in GEO agency. Generative platforms often prioritize content that is concise, structured, authoritative, and easy to interpret.
Building an Effective GEO Strategy for Visibility in Generative Search
Create Answer-First Content
AI systems prefer content that delivers immediate value. Instead of lengthy introductions, begin sections with direct answers to common questions.
For example, if the topic is "What is Generative Engine Optimization?", provide a concise definition immediately before expanding on the concept.
This structure makes it easier for AI models to extract and cite relevant information.
Focus on Topical Authority
Generative search engines evaluate expertise and trustworthiness when selecting sources. Publishing comprehensive content clusters around a subject helps establish authority.
Rather than creating isolated blog posts, build interconnected resources that cover:
Beginner guides
Industry trends
Case studies
FAQs
Expert insights
The broader and deeper your content coverage, the stronger your authority signals become.
Strengthen Author Credibility
AI systems increasingly consider who created the content, not just what was written. Detailed author profiles, professional credentials, industry experience, and transparent expertise signals help improve trust.
Content associated with recognized experts often carries greater citation potential in generative search environments.
Structure Content for AI Extraction
A successful GEO strategy for visibility in generative search requires content that is easy for machines to parse.
Best practices include:
Clear headings and subheadings
Question-based sections
Concise paragraphs
Fact-supported statements
Definitions and summaries
FAQ sections
AI models often extract individual passages rather than entire articles, making content structure a critical ranking factor for GEO success.
Include Trust Signals and Citations
Generative engines prefer content supported by credible evidence. Industry statistics, expert quotes, research findings, and referenced data can increase the likelihood of being cited.
Trust signals help AI systems evaluate the reliability of information before incorporating it into generated answers.

GEO and SEO: Working Together
One of the biggest misconceptions is that GEO will replace SEO. In reality, they work best together.
SEO helps search engines discover and rank content. GEO helps AI systems understand and reference that content. A modern content strategy combines both disciplines to maximize visibility across traditional and AI-driven search experiences.
Successful brands are creating content that serves both human audiences and AI systems simultaneously. This dual approach is becoming essential for long-term digital growth.
